Output 34fbbda5fe6b2955ade848ec6b3a54f97ae3567df07a9f25e93392ab2c6807fb:0

value
1956731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73afaddb4df02034ea5d09a3e2b00c7aa5dcb67d OP_EQUAL
address
3CEi61BocM53fTRaqk8R3cBx1djPZCsz5Z
transaction
34fbbda5fe6b2955ade848ec6b3a54f97ae3567df07a9f25e93392ab2c6807fb